**Handover: Castwren Feed Validator — for on-call**

Leaving this for whoever takes the pager tonight. The Castwren podcast feed validator is mid-migration: the RSS schema checks run on the new worker pool, but enclosure-size validation still hits the old one. If the old pool dies, feeds will pass incorrectly — restart it from the sealed runbook bundle. The bundle is encrypted; to open it you will need the recovery passphrase below.

unlock words, hahip-baduf: holwyn-istath-julvan

On-call engineers should never disable the sweeper outright; instead, tag resources with a hold marker to exempt them. False-positive deletions are recoverable from the quarantine bucket for 30 days. Configuration changes, exemption policy, and incident escalations for the sweeper all go through the maintainer listed below.

account owner for bawip-tahag: Raleth Quenok

## Alert: StatRelay Sidecar Flush Lag

This alert fires when the StatRelay metrics-aggregation sidecar falls more than 120 seconds behind on flushing buffered samples to the Coalmine backend. Plugin-emitted counters are buffered in-process, so sustained lag usually means a plugin is emitting unbounded label cardinality or blocking the flush thread. Check your plugin's metric registration against the published cardinality limits before escalating. If the lag persists after your plugin is ruled out, contact the telemetry team.

escalation mailbox, bagug-fahof: novdor.wendor.jormir@norvalabs.example